Black-crowned barwing

(Actinodura sodangorum)

Description

The black-crowned barwing (Actinodura sodangorum) is a species of bird in the Leiothrichidae family.It is found in Laos and Vietnam.Its natural habitats are subtropical or tropical moist montane forests,subtropical or tropical high-altitude shrubland,subtropical or tropical high-altitude grassland,and plantations.It is threatened by habitat loss.
